Next up in the Fanzine journey is Cadla Magazine # Next up in the Fanzine journey is Cadla Magazine #4 

This was a great Swedish zine run by Sverker "Widda" Widgren back in the 90's.
Sverker is nowadays perhaps more known for being the guitarist/vocalist in the highly underrated band - Diabolical. He also has a past in Centinex & Demonical, but also as a Studio techician/producer etc. for a lot of great bands.

Let's stay in Sweden for another Zine. This time Let's stay in Sweden for another Zine. 
This time a split-zine between Near Dark & Goetia from 1996.

Near Dark from Sundsvall is perhaps also more known for the label Near Dark Productions that had some great compilation releases followed by released with Sorhin, Blot Mine, Steel etc. 

Farbror Fällström is still one of the pillars when it comes to organizing Metal in the North of Sweden with Club Deströyer & Nordfest in Sundsvall. Whom I am glad to call a friend since there is less and less people (well, at least us old people) who has this fire still burning within us.

As for the Goetia side of the fanzine - the content is killer and what I really love is the Demo review section with band-logos. Back in those days logos & thanks-lists was the shit when it came to look up new bands. Cool logo = tape-trading or try to contact the band. Thanks-lists = Try to find something at the local record store, otherwise - tape-trading.

Back to Sweden and Putrefaction Issue: 6 this time Back to Sweden and Putrefaction Issue: 6 this time. All the way back to 1991 based on the internet. All I know is that it is old and from a great time to be alive when it comes to being a teenager into Underground Metal. 

I was 14 years back old in 1991 and had gone from Twisted Sister, W.A.S.P. to Metallica, Slayer to Entombed, Morbid Angel, Samael etc. by then. (1992 would although be when the flood gates to the world of Black Metal truly opened).

Putrefaction ´Zine was a cool fanzine for sure. The creator, Tomas Nyqvist, however etched his name into the history books a year later with his infamous label No Fashion Records. 

NFR was from the start a label where you could buy an album pretty much "blindly" and know that you would get quality. Or at least between 1992-1999 with few errors. Shit happened, but I won't get into that old story. Google "bardo methodology + No Fashion Records" and you will get a much better story from the man himself.
